Triumph Tiger 900 Rally Pro 2024

Triumph Tiger 900 Rally Pro 2024

The Triumph Tiger 900 Rally Pro impresses as a versatile all-rounder that cuts a fine figure both on the road and off-road. Its comfort features and balanced suspension offer amateur riders a pleasant experience, although it does not reach the top in extreme off-road situations. The Tiger impresses with its elastic three-cylinder engine and solid features, although the slow menu start is a little annoying. Overall, it is a universal bike that offers a successful compromise between touring, sportiness and off-road performance.
